¿Cómo ejecuto un script con la biblioteca python-evtx, desde la terminal de PyCharm?
Estoy ejecutando un script que lee información de archivos de registro de eventos de Windows (evtx). Estoy utilizando la excelente biblioteca de Willi Ballenthin https://github.com/williballenthin/python-evtx.
Sin embargo, después de haber instalado python-evtx y luego importarlo en el script como
import Evtx.Evtx as evtx
Pycharm todavía se queja de que no puede encontrarlo.
Puedo ejecutar el mismo script desde el Command Prompt o PowerShell, pero no desde Pycharm.
Me gustaría ejecutarlo desde el IDE de Pycharm para poder usar las funciones del IDE como el depurador, los watches y los puntos de interrupción.
Soy nuevo en Python / Pycharm y estoy ejecutando Pycharm en una máquina virtual de VMware con Windows 10, con Python 3.9.3. Cualquier guía es apreciada y recibida con gratitud.
davy.ai
Solución para resolver el problema de Pycharm de no encontrar una biblioteca instalada
Si has instalado la biblioteca
python-evtx
y aún enfrentas el problema de que Pycharm no puede encontrarla, puedes seguir los siguientes pasos para resolverlo:Este comando mostrará los detalles de la instalación de la biblioteca.
python-evtx
. Puedes comprobar esto yendo a:Archivo -> Configuración -> Proyecto: <nombre_de_proyecto> -> Intérprete de Python
Asegúrate de que la ruta del intérprete de Python apunte a la ubicación correcta.
python-evtx
específicamente para el entorno de Pycharm. Puedes hacer esto abriendo la terminal de Pycharm y ejecutando el siguiente comando:Esto instalará la biblioteca específicamente para el entorno de Pycharm y debería resolver el problema.
python-evtx
en ese entorno. Puedes hacer esto yendo a:Archivo -> Configuración -> Proyecto: <nombre_de_proyecto> -> Intérprete de Python
Haz clic en el icono de engranaje y selecciona “Agregar…”. Selecciona “Entorno Virtual” y sigue las instrucciones para crear un nuevo entorno virtual. Una vez creado el entorno, haz clic en el icono “+” para instalar la biblioteca
python-evtx
en el entorno virtual.Siguiendo estos pasos, deberías poder resolver el problema de que Pycharm no puede encontrar una biblioteca instalada.